UNDP, Norway Holds Competition for Ending Plastic Waste in the Indonesian Marine

PRESS RELEASE

Jakarta, 16 March 2021 – UNDP (United Nations Development Programme) with the Ministry of Foreign Affairs of Norway and NORAD (Norwegian Agency for Development Cooperation) held a marine waste management competition again in Indonesia. The competition, entitled EPPIC (Ending Plastic Pollution Innovation Challenge) phase 2, is a continuation of the previous EPPIC which focuses on ASEAN countries. 

The first phase of EPPIC was held last year, focusing on Ha Long Bay Vietnam and Koh Samui Thailand, for the second phase will be implemented by focusing on Indonesia and Philippines.

The aim of the EPPIC competition is to provide a pathway for the latest innovative solutions that can have real implications and be able to contribute to society not only environmentally, but also economically and socio-culturally. 

Sophie Kemkhdaze, as Deputy Resident Representative of UNDP Indonesia said, “Based on other studies, it shows that Southeast Asia is the region with the largest contribution to plastic leakage in the marine. UNDP hopes that EPPIC can contribute to decrease this number through the emergence of innovative solutions, their development and replication.”

Research from the Indonesian Institute of Sciences (LIPI) states that around 268,740 – 594,558 tons of plastic waste are leaking into Indonesia’s marine every year. The Oceanographic Research Center of LIPI estimates that the rough potential value of Indonesia’s marine until March 2019 is worth 1,772 trillion. The large potential value of the marine then makes Indonesia have to pay specific attention to the marine conditions. 

“From the previous 2020 EPPIC in Vietnam and Thailand, we already saw solutions from private companies, NGOs, and the academia originating in many ASEAN countries. This year, we will see contributions targeting Indonesia and the Philippines. It will increase the power of the ASEAN region, ASEAN’s region multilateral partnership, as we tackle these issues in Southeast Asia,” Kemkhdaze concluded. 

Novrizal Tahar, Director of Waste Management, KLHK (Ministry of Environment and Forestry of the Republic of Indonesia) as well as Secretary of the National Action Plan for Marine Waste Management said, “The Indonesian government has taken steps to reduce waste and plastic pollution from upstream to downstream. We certainly really appreciate the EPPIC program. The problem related to waste has been a problem not only faced by Indonesia or ASEAN, but also throughout the world. This has been proven by including this issue in one of the number 14 sustainable development goals, Life Below Water, which surely become the focus of the Indonesian government as an archipelagic country that is surrounded by the sea. “

Plastic pollution has become a big problem for the world and Indonesia. Until now, Indonesian people are still very dependent on the use of plastic, both as food wrappers and as shopping bags. This happens because plastic is an option that is relatively cheap and easy to obtain so that it can reduce production costs. 

Apart from habitual factors, another factor that is quite influential in managing plastic pollution is the difficulty in the process of decomposing plastics. It is difficult for plastics to decompose naturally, as a result plastic waste tends to remain in the same condition and content over a very long period of time. 

EPPIC hopefully will raise innovations that can help to tackle the problem of plastic pollution, provide an economic boost, and foster public understanding of the dangers and impacts of plastic pollution for human and biological survival.
